What to check before choosing a building with gyms near the W train in NYC
- Use the W-train proximity filter to reduce commute time, then confirm the walk time on Google Maps at your target arrival window.
- For the “with-gym” filter, ask whether the gym is on-site, in-building vs. sister-property access, and whether it requires an additional fee.
- Check access rules in writing (key fob hours, class enrollment, capacity limits, guest policy, and any seasonal closures).
- Verify whether utilities, deposits, and any amenity fees change your full monthly cost, not just the asking rent.
- If you’re relying on building reviews, cross-check with a quick tenant question about cleanliness, equipment wear, and maintenance response after outages.
